Page 2 <br /> <br /> <br /> 2 <br />A Commissioner asked about the days and hours of operations. The applicant stated that days are <br />Monday through Friday, with an occasional Saturday, from 7 am to 5 pm. Up to two staff, to start <br />with, on site during the day. <br /> <br />A Commissioner asked about any rental of the property. The applicant has stated, if a portion of <br />the property or building was rented, it might be for someone that helps fixes the containers on the <br />property. Any renter would need to meet all of the conditions in the CUP and zoning district. <br /> <br />The Planning Commission agreed that the proposed amendment was generally consistent with <br />what is currently on the property and liked with the conditions in the CUP. The Planning <br />Commission agreed the application met the requirements necessary to approve the CUP <br />amendment and unanimously recommended approval to the City Council. <br /> <br />2. DESCRIPTION OF REQUEST: <br /> <br />The applicant is requesting approval of a conditional use permit (CUP) amendment for the <br />property located at 16028 Forest Boulevard North. The applicant would like to amend the CUP <br />to include items related to the business operations and the type of exterior storage. The property <br />is 20 acres and includes a 7,500 square foot office building and three accessory buildings. <br /> <br />3. BACKGROUND: <br /> <br />In the Restricted Industrial zoning district, exterior storage is only allowed with a conditional use <br />permit. There is an existing CUP for the property for exterior storage. Lametti and Son’s <br />currently owns the property and they are a sewer and water utility contractor. The existing CUP <br />allows exterior storage of material and equipment and processing of cured-in-place pipe that was <br />be done inside of an existing building. The items currently stored outdoors include outdoor <br />processing of industrial pipes and fittings, sewer and water utility materials, vehicles, and heavy <br />equipment. A CUP has been approved for the site since prior to 1970 and has been amended over <br />time for changes to the exterior storage and operation of the business. Most recently the CUP was <br />amended in 2007 to make changes to be current the business operations, uses on the site, and <br />exterior storage. <br /> <br />The applicant has a purchase agreement for the property and the proposed use is a location for <br />exterior storage of items related to Dart Portable Storage. The business offers portable storage <br />containers for delivery to a homeowner’s residence, where the unit can be used for storage for a <br />move, remodel, or project at home. The containers can also be delivered to construction sites or <br />retail stores looking for extra space during renovations or holiday seasons. The items stored on <br />the site will be empty and no personal storage shall be on site. The property will be used for <br />outdoor storage of the following items: <br /> <br />• Semi-trucks (tractor only) 5 to 6 <br />• Storage semi-trailers (trailers only) 50-125 <br />• Storage container pods 50-125 <br />• Office container pods 20-50
